The cost of construction site grading in Nashua, NH, can vary significantly based on a variety of factors. Site grading is a crucial step in preparing land for construction, ensuring proper drainage, and creating a stable foundation for buildings. Understanding the factors that influence these costs and common tasks involved can help you budget effectively for your project.

Factors Affecting Cost

  • Site Size: Larger sites generally require more work and resources.
  • Soil Type: Different soil types can affect the ease of grading and may require specialized equipment.
  • Slope and Terrain: Steeper slopes and uneven terrain can increase the complexity and cost of grading.
  • Accessibility: Sites that are difficult to access may incur additional transportation and labor costs.
  • Permits and Regulations: Local regulations and the need for permits can add to the overall cost.
  • Weather Conditions: Adverse weather can delay work and increase labor costs.
  • Equipment Used: The type and amount of equipment required can impact the total cost.
  • Labor Rates: Local labor rates in Nashua, NH, will affect the overall cost of the project.

Average Costs for Common Tasks

Task Average Cost (Nashua, NH)
Site Survey $500 - $1,200
Basic Site Grading $1,000 - $3,000 per acre
Excavation $50 - $200 per cubic yard
Soil Testing $800 - $2,000
Erosion Control Measures $500 - $2,500
Land Clearing $1,500 - $5,000 per acre
Drainage System Installation $2,000 - $6,000
Final Grading $1,000 - $4,000 per acre
